The industrial application of non-shrinkage films is one of the largest and most crucial sectors in the market. These films are predominantly used for packaging heavy equipment, machinery, and construction materials. Their robust protective qualities prevent products from damage during transportation and handling. Non-shrinkage films provide a strong, secure barrier against environmental factors such as dust, moisture, and UV radiation, which can compromise the quality and longevity of industrial goods. Additionally, non-shrinkage films help in reducing the costs associated with packaging materials and labor. The ability to customize these films to fit different shapes and sizes of industrial products makes them highly versatile, driving demand in industries such as automotive, electronics, and construction. Furthermore, the increasing need for durable and cost-effective packaging solutions is expected to propel the growth of this segment, positioning it as a major player in the non-shrinkage film market.
The pharmaceutical and medical sector requires highly specialized packaging materials to ensure the safety, integrity, and shelf-life of sensitive products. Non-shrinkage films are widely used in this industry for wrapping pharmaceutical products, medical devices, and diagnostic kits. The films offer a secure protective layer that shields these sensitive items from contamination, moisture, and physical damage. Non-shrinkage films used in the pharmaceutical industry must meet stringent quality standards to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ements. They are also used for tamper-evident packaging, ensuring that products remain sealed and uncontaminated during storage and transportation. The growing demand for pharmaceutical products, driven by an aging population and increasing healthcare needs, is expected to fuel growth in the pharmaceutical and medical applications segment. Non-shrinkage films contribute to the efficiency and safety of the pharmaceutical supply chain, making them a critical component in the sector.
The food and beverage industry is one of the largest consumers of non-shrinkage films, utilizing them primarily for product packaging. These films help to maintain the freshness, quality, and safety of food and beverage items by acting as a protective barrier against moisture, air, and contaminants. Non-shrinkage films are used extensively for packaging perishable goods such as fruits, vegetables, dairy products, snacks, and beverages. In addition, these films provide excellent sealing properties, ensuring that products remain hygienic and free from external contamination during transportation and storage. As consumer demand for convenient, ready-to-eat food continues to grow, non-shrinkage films have become an essential tool for ensuring food safety and extending shelf life. Moreover, the rise in e-commerce and online grocery shopping has further accelerated the demand for reliable, protective packaging solutions in this sector.
The "Others" segment in the non-shrinkage film market includes a variety of niche applications in different industries, such as electronics, textiles, and consumer goods. In the electronics industry, non-shrinkage films are used for packaging sensitive electronic components and devices, protecting them from static, moisture, and mechanical damage. In the textile sector, these films are used for wrapping fabrics and garments, ensuring they remain intact and free from dirt or damage during storage and shipping. Similarly, consumer goods manufacturers rely on non-shrinkage films for packaging products like household items, toys, and personal care products. As industries continue to innovate and expand, the demand for specialized packaging solutions is likely to drive further growth in this diverse "Others" segment, highlighting the wide-ranging utility of non-shrinkage films in various applications.

Several key trends are shaping the non-shrinkage film market. Firstly, there is a growing emphasis on sustainability and eco-friendly packaging solutions. With increasing awareness of environmental issues and the need to reduce plastic waste, manufacturers are focusing on developing non-shrinkage films made from biodegradable or recyclable materials. This trend is particularly prominent in the food and beverage and pharmaceutical industries, where packaging sustainability is becoming a key driver of consumer decisions.
Another important trend is the increasing adoption of advanced technologies in film production. Innovations in film manufacturing processes, such as the use of multi-layer films, have improved the strength, flexibility, and barrier properties of non-shrinkage films. These advancements allow for better customization of films to meet the specific needs of different industries, further expanding their applicability across various sectors.
Furthermore, the rise of e-commerce has had a significant impact on the demand for non-shrinkage films. The need for reliable and durable packaging solutions to ensure safe delivery of products has boosted the adoption of non-shrinkage films in various sectors, including retail, pharmaceuticals, and food and beverage.

1. What is a non-shrinkage film?
A non-shrinkage film is a type of plastic film that does not shrink or deform under heat, offering durable protection for packaged goods.
2. Where are non-shrinkage films commonly used?
Non-shrinkage films are commonly used in industrial, pharmaceutical, food and beverage, and other sectors for packaging and protective applications.
3. What are the benefits of non-shrinkage films in packaging?
Non-shrinkage films provide protection against moisture, dust, and physical damage, ensuring product safety and integrity during transportation and storage.
4. Are non-shrinkage films eco-friendly?
Some non-shrinkage films are made from recyclable or biodegradable materials, contributing to more sustainable packaging solutions.
5. How do non-shrinkage films differ from shrink films?
Unlike shrink films, which shrink when exposed to heat, non-shrinkage films retain their original shape and size, providing stable and durable protection.
6. Can non-shrinkage films be customized for different applications?
Yes, non-shrinkage films can be customized in terms of thickness, strength, and barrier properties to meet the specific needs of different industries.
